You are booking hotel for more than 30 days
Varkala Beach, Varkala | 4 minutes walk to Varkala Beach
Temple Road
Varkala
Munroe Island
Varkala
Punnamada
Aaliyirakkam Beach
Kurakkanni
Kovalam Beach
Varkala Beach
Sea View Ward
Kurakkanni
Odayam Beach
Mundayil Road
Temple Road
Varkala Beach
Varkala Beach
Varkala Beach
Varkala Beach
Kurakkanni
Varkala Beach